QUESTION:

Why will Outlook Express not allow me to download certain attachments and why is the security option "greyed" out?

POSSIBLE SOLUTION(S):

You are unable to receive attachments because the Outlook Express setting "Do not allow attachments to be opened or saved that could potentially be a virus" is checked and greyed out.

Tellurian has created the following procedure to address this problem:

  1. Make sure that no programs are currently running, including Outlook Express
  2. Click Start, then Run
  3. In the Run dialog box, type "regedit" into the "Open:" field without quotes and click "OK"
  4. Once REGEDIT is open, click the plus (+) symbol by H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E
  5. Click the plus (+) symbol by SOFTWARE
  6. Click the plus (+) symbol by Microsoft
  7. Click on "Outlook Express" once to highlight it
  8. In the right hand pane, double-click "BlockExeAttachments"
  9. For "Value Data" enter 0 and then click "OK"
  10. Exit REGEDIT and restart your machine
  11. After your machine restarts, open Outlook Express and go to Tools > Options and then to the Security tab. The option "Do not allow attachments to be opened or saved that could potentially be a virus" can be checked or unchecked it based on your preference.
